Florals Rule SS 2008 Fashion

Florals are making a comeback this spring. The revival of summer prints has been showcased in many of the current season’s ready-to-wear collections.

Monique Lhuillier Spring 2008 Ready To Wear

We’ve already shown you the Monique Lhuillier Fall/Winter 2008-2009 - today, the spring RTW!
Monique Lhullier’s spring collection was the stuff a modern-day princess’s dreams are made of –ruffly fluffy confections reminiscent of her inspiration – Laduree Macaroons from the famous patisserie on the Champs Elysee in Paris.

Sundresses: Classic Summer Style

sun•dress / ?s?n?dres/ • n. a light, loose, sleeveless dress, typically having a wide neckline and thin shoulder straps.

Iodice Fashion Catwalk F/W 2008

Iodice is a great and fresh label from Brazil, and these photos of their Sao Paolo Fashion Week runway show exactly why: classy clothing with lots of pretty colors, great use of accessories (I love the belt buckles) and lovely designs. Absolutely awesome!
